We are North East Spicy Coffee Collective - a group of SWers based in North East England who want to create autonomous social spaces where we can relax and chat, free from stigma and judgement. We are not a charity - we are simply a group of SWers who want to build community with one another & help each other out! All current SWers are welcome to come to events and all forms of SW are valid. We are a trans inclusive space and welcome people of all genders to come join us.
We are horizontally structured - we do not need bosses or leaders to organise for us. There is a zero tolerance policy for transphobia, homophobia, racism, fatphobia, xenophobia, whorephobia or albeism and we do not engage with police.
Meet ups happen at different venues around the region on the last Tuesday of every month, 11am - 2pm - however, this is flexible and can change depending on people's capacity and venue access! Events are a sober space and based on mutual aid principles - workers can drop in at any time for a hot drink and moan.
We have free condoms, menstrual products, harm reduction supplies and literature, sex worker rights and support literature, a free shop and a mini library
